green bean and sausage bake

This recipe is easy to make and is so versatile. You can replace the green beans with broccoli or asparagus, or any other veggie of your choice. It is just important to use fresh veggies for the best flavor.

prep time 15 Min
cook time 35 Min
method Bake
yield 6 serving(s)

Ingredients

  • 14 ounces green beans, fresh
  • 8 ounces mozzarella cheese, shredded
  • 16 ounces Alfredo sauce
  • 1/2 pound ground beef
  • 1/2 pound italian pork sausage
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 4 ounces Parmesan cheese, shredded
  • 1 cup bacon, crumbled
  • 1 tablespoon garlic powder
  • 1 tablespoon onion powder
  • 1 tablespoon Italian seasoning
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1 teaspoon black pepper

How To Make green bean and sausage bake

  • Step 1
    Wash your green beans and place them on a lined baking sheet.
  • Step 2
    Drizzle olive oil on your beans.
  • Step 3
    Layer your cooked (and drained) meat mixture on top and do not stir together. Leave in layers.
  • Step 4
    Top with your Alfredo sauce (I prefer Rao's brand) and spread to cover the meat mixture.
  • Step 5
    Top with your seasonings and then your cheeses.
  • Step 6
    Bake at 350 degrees F for approximately 35 minutes or until your green beans are done to your liking.
